Given :
Ryan works two jobs. He earns $10 per hour working at the hardware store, and he earns $13 per hour working at the shipping.
To Find :
If x represents hours at the hardware store and y represents hours at the shipping company, which inequality represents the situation if Ryan wants to earn a minimum of $300.
Solution :
His total earning is given by :
T = 10( number of hours at hardware store ) + 13( number of hours at the shipping)
T = 10x + 13y
Now, he wants to earn a minimum of $300 i.e T ≥ $300.
So, 10x + 13y ≥ 300
Hence, this is the required solution.

2/3 / 1/6
When dividing by a fraction, flip the second fraction over and change divide to multiply:
2/3 x 6/1 = (2 x6) / (3 x 1) = 12/3 = 4
The answer is 4
